Presidential Candidate Daniel Imperato To Host United Nations Reception

August 28, 2007 - American Basketball Association (ABA)
Palm Beach Imperials News Release


New York City, NY. 2008 Independent Libertarian Presidential Candidate and owner of the ABA Palm Beach Imperial basketball team, has announced that he will be hosting a reception for world leaders and corporate dignitaries entitled, "Gathering the Nations."

The cocktail reception will take place on September 25, 2007 at the Waldorf-Astoria Hotel in New York City during eh United Nations (UN) General Assembly from 6-8pm. The event will be held in the Conrad Salon, and the dress code will be business attire.

Currently, Imperato, through the Imperato Worldwide Association, is corresponding with Presidents and Prime Ministers of various nations around the world along with UN Ambassadors to attend.

The reception has been designed to launch a new collaboration, led by Mr. Imperato, with humanitarian organizations, international governments, and financiers to implement and develop approximately $70 billion of identified humanitarian projects in over 40 countries around the world.

The event is being sponsored by Imperiali Organization LLC and other select companies in conjunction with several Guests of Honor organizations who Imperato represents. Those organizations are: Orden Bonaria, Knights of Malta, National Union of American Families, the Imperato Foundation, African Center Foundation, Latin/African American Chaplains Association and The Holy See, where Imperato serves as a Papal Knight.
